Re: Trying an experiment

using white envelopes with light cardboard and the chip in a protector scotched tape so it wont move and the cardboard to make the envelope smooth so when it goes through the sorter it takes it easier. I sent 2 out as test trials one to the east and the other to the west. I want to see if this works for $.41. This is for a cheaper $1 chip. I will not do that for a chip I can not replace or an expensive chip. I will then have to pay the $1.13.

As another idea is try and keep your trades/buys to a 2 chip minimum if you can. It is more cost affective.

1 chip went from $.52 to $1.13
2 chips can still probably stay under an ounce same price. A bit more cost affective
3 chips goes up to $1.30 (That is the price of the 2 ounce)

Again, our packages now fall under the parcel CATEGORY. This is why the price jumped so high. The USPO is now making us pay for all the bubble wrappers they have previously had to sort manually and have to hire more workers due to the high demand of packages. I have spent many hrs in the PO talking to the workers about why they did this and how it works. Some of the other offices have not figured this out after years and years of doing it the old way.
